Ukraine Unveils FP-5 Flamingo Cruise Missile

Ukraine has developed the FP-5 Flamingo, a long-range cruise missile with a range of 3,000 km and a 1,150 kg warhead, making it one of the heaviest in its class. Powered by an Ivchenko AI-25 turbofan, it cruises at 850–900 km/h with GPS/GNSS guidance and a Circular Error Probable (CEP) of about 14 meters. Though large and non-stealthy, the missile’s destructive payload enables strikes on major infrastructure across Russia. Initial production is one per day, with plans to scale up. The Flamingo reflects Ukraine’s push for cost-effective, scalable weapons to boost deep-strike capabilities.
